The EPO Opposition Challenge

EPO opposition is a powerful tool — available to any third party within 9 months of a patent grant, it can revoke or significantly limit a patent across all EPO-designated states. For pharmaceutical companies whose products are blocked by competitor patents, opposition is often the most cost-effective route to challenging the block.

For patent holders defending against opposition, the prior art mobilisation pressure is intense. The opponent has had months to prepare their prior art case. The patent holder must respond with prior art arguments, claim amendments if needed, and a complete invalidity analysis of the opponent’s cited references — all within the EPO’s examination timeline.

Non-Patent Literature: The Critical Prior Art for Pharma

In pharmaceutical patent prosecution and invalidity proceedings, non-patent literature is not supplementary prior art. It is often the primary prior art. Clinical publications, pharmacological studies, conference abstracts, and regulatory submissions frequently predate patent applications by years — and constitute the most relevant prior art for novelty and obviousness challenges against drug and biologic claims.

Standard European prior art search tools, including ESPACENET, do not index NPL. A pharmaceutical patent opposition built on patent prior art alone is systematically missing the most relevant and most persuasive category of evidence — the clinical and scientific literature that the EPO’s own Technical Boards of Appeal frequently cite as decisive prior art.

SPC Strategy Across 40+ Member States

Supplementary protection certificates are national rights — granted by each EU member state’s national patent office on the basis of the EU marketing authorisation for the drug product. Managing SPC applications across 40+ EPO member states involves coordinating different filing deadlines, different national requirements, and different durations based on the regulatory approval timeline in each jurisdiction.

The SPC strategy challenge is fundamentally a portfolio lifecycle management problem — which patents cover which products, in which jurisdictions, for how long, and with what exposure to invalidity challenge. Biosimilar Entry: The Invalidity Challenge Timeline

When a biosimilar manufacturer files for regulatory approval of a reference biologic, the first legal challenge that follows is typically an invalidity proceeding against the blocking patents. For the reference product holder, the timeline is compressed: the biosimilar application can be confidential until regulatory approval is imminent, leaving limited time for prior art preparation before the invalidity proceedings begin.

Teams that have already run AI-powered invalidity assessments on their core biologic patents — as part of ongoing portfolio management, not in response to a biosimilar threat — know their exposure before the challenge arrives. Teams that have not face the invalidity proceedings with weeks to prepare what takes months to do manually.
